Wearing Your Indigo Art

Join us for Wearing Your Indigo Art, an artisan-level, two-day studio workshop led by renowned indigo artist, textile designer, and educator Arianne King Comer. Designed for participants seeking an immersive, hands-on experience, this workshop explores the artistry of indigo dyeing through wax resist and paste resist techniques while guiding guests in the creation of unique wearable pieces.

Arianne King Comer is a multimedia textile artist known for her indigo and batik work, with more than 25 years of experience in the textile field. Her practice is deeply connected to indigo, batik, cultural tradition, and personal heritage. She developed her passion for indigo while studying under renowned batik artist Nike Davies-Okundaye in Nigeria, and she continues to teach indigo and batik workshops in South Carolina and around the world. Her work has been exhibited across the United States and is included in several permanent collections.

Across two days, participants will learn about indigo’s history and context, explore different vat types, and receive guided demonstrations in wax resist, paste resist, dyeing, and cleaning fabric after the wax process. Starter fabrics will be used for initial exercises, allowing participants to build confidence with the techniques before moving into open studio time.

Day one will focus on demonstration, technique, and creative exploration, including resist methods, vat dyeing, and hands-on experimentation. Day two will be dedicated to open studio work, giving participants time to apply what they have learned to clothing or fabric pieces they bring from home.

This intimate studio experience is ideal for artists, makers, textile enthusiasts, and creative learners interested in transforming fabric into wearable indigo art through the guidance of a master dyer.
